PDA

View Full Version : نصب لاراول 5



A.ardalan far
پنج شنبه 14 اسفند 1393, 13:32 عصر
سلام دوستان
من طبق داکیومنت لاراول جلو رفتم و تمام فرایند نصب درست انجام دادم php5.5.4 و ماژول های مورد نیاز هم فعاله فقط فقط در


http://localhost/laravel/public/

صفحه کلا بدون ارور و چیزی هم لود نمیشه اصلا
مشکل به نظرتون از کجاست؟
لاراول یک ویو تست نداره بدونم درست نصب کردم یا نه؟

rezakho
جمعه 15 اسفند 1393, 10:46 صبح
باید چند مورد رو بررسی کنید

قبل از همه چیز، نسخه آماده لاراول رو از اینجا (http://barnamenevis.org/showthread.php?444603-%D8%A2%D8%AE%D8%B1%DB%8C%D9%86-%D9%86%D8%B3%D8%AE%D9%87-%D9%87%D8%A7%DB%8C-%D8%A2%D9%85%D8%A7%D8%AF%D9%87-Laravel&p=2171738&viewfull=1#post2171738) بگیری و این رو تست کنید، اگر مجدد چیزی ندیدید، موارد زیر رو برید جلو

1- ماژول rewrite آپاچی فعال باشه
2- AllowOverride All رو پوشتون توی آپاچی اعمال شده باشه
3- ارورهای php روشن باشه
4- وابستگی ها به درستی نصب شده باشه

A.ardalan far
جمعه 15 اسفند 1393, 12:54 عصر
1.2 درسته
3 رو فعال کردم اینو میگه الان



Warning: require(/var/www/laravel/bootstrap/../vendor/autoload.php): failed to open stream: No such file or directory in /var/www/laravel/bootstrap/autoload.php on line 17

Fatal error: require(): Failed opening required '/var/www/laravel/bootstrap/../vendor/autoload.php' (include_path='.:/usr/share/php:/usr/share/pear') in /var/www/laravel/bootstrap/autoload.php on line 17


لینک دانلود هم مشکل داشت و با دستور composer دانلود کردم و با گیت هابشم تست کردم. فقط و فقط عیب کار اینه:


ubuntu@ubuntu-msi:~$ composer global require "laravel/installer=~1.1"
'Changed current directory to /home/ubuntu/.composer
./composer.json has been updated
Loading composer repositories with package information
Updating dependencies (including require-dev)
Nothing to install or update
Generating autoload files
ubuntu@ubuntu-msi:~$ '

A.ardalan far
جمعه 15 اسفند 1393, 14:27 عصر
مشکل حل شد.مشکل از composer بود
برای دوستان بگم که:
تو سایت:
https://getcomposer.org/download/
با استفاده از Latest Snapshot (https://getcomposer.org/composer.phar) دانلود کنن composer رو و بعد انتقال بدن به:


/use/bin/local

دقت کنید حتما و حتما دسترسی فایل رو درست کنید
و بعد composer install برای نصب پکیچ های وابسته

موارد بالا هم ک دوستمون ذکر هم حتما حتما با


<?php phpinfo() ?>

چک کنید
------------------------------
یه سوال داشتم این که وقتی با composer وابستگی ها رو میگیریم حجم پوشه ای لاراول میشه ۲۱ مگ . composer یه پوشه میسازه به اسم vendor و کتابخونه ها رو میزاره درون پوشه . خیلی کتابخونه ها بی ربطه دیگه هم هست .میشه پاک کرد و فقط laravel گذاشت؟

rezakho
جمعه 15 اسفند 1393, 22:28 عصر
اون کتابخونه ها بی ربط نیستند
:)
لاراول برای اجرا به اونها وابسته هست، بهشون میگن وابستگی